yii2使用数据库记录错误信息

发布时间 - 2020-02-26 00:00:00    点击率:

命令行创建错误日志表

1、配置文件:console\config\main.php

'components' => [
    'log' => [
        'targets' => [
            [
                'class' => 'yii\log\FileTarget',
                'levels' => ['error', 'warning'],
            ],
            [
                'class' => 'yii\log\DbTarget',  //使用数据库记录日志
                'levels' => ['error', 'warning'],
            ]           
        ],
    ]
],

2、cd 到项目根目录,在common模块配置好数据库配置,执行命令行创建表:

(推荐教程:yii框架)

php yii migrate --migrationPath=@yii/log/migrations/

修改配置文件:backend\config\main.php

'components' => [
    ... ...
    'log' => [
        'traceLevel' => YII_DEBUG ? 3 : 0,
        'targets' => [
            [
                'class' => 'yii\log\FileTarget',
                'levels' => ['error', 'warning'],
            ],
            [
                'class' => 'yii\log\DbTarget',  //使用数据库记录日志
                'levels' => ['error', 'warning'],
            ]
        ],
    ],
    ... ...
]

更多编程相关内容,请关注编程入门栏目!


# php  # console  # 数据库  # YII  # 命令行  # 配置文件  # 相关内容  # keji  # cn  # hongkong  # aliyucs  # main  # ig 


相关栏目: 【 网站优化151355 】 【 网络推广146373 】 【 网络技术251813 】 【 AI营销90571


相关推荐: Gemini手机端怎么发图片_Gemini手机端发图方法【步骤】  如何用已有域名快速搭建网站?  如何在阿里云虚拟机上搭建网站?步骤解析与避坑指南  实例解析Array和String方法  Chrome浏览器标签页分组怎么用_谷歌浏览器整理标签页技巧【效率】  Laravel怎么集成Vue.js_Laravel Mix配置Vue开发环境  如何在IIS7上新建站点并设置安全权限?  php静态变量怎么调试_php静态变量作用域调试技巧【解答】  Python函数文档自动校验_规范解析【教程】  如何制作公司的网站链接,公司想做一个网站,一般需要花多少钱?  悟空识字怎么关闭自动续费_悟空识字取消会员自动扣费步骤  Android中Textview和图片同行显示(文字超出用省略号,图片自动靠右边)  Python并发异常传播_错误处理解析【教程】  专业型网站制作公司有哪些,我设计专业的,谁给推荐几个设计师兼职类的网站?  大型企业网站制作流程,做网站需要注册公司吗?  Javascript中的事件循环是如何工作的_如何利用Javascript事件循环优化异步代码?  Laravel怎么在Blade中安全地输出原始HTML内容  如何用PHP工具快速搭建高效网站?  如何在景安云服务器上绑定域名并配置虚拟主机?  如何在景安服务器上快速搭建个人网站?  大连网站制作费用,大连新青年网站,五年四班里的视频怎样下载啊?  北京网站制作公司哪家好一点,北京租房网站有哪些?  如何在服务器上三步完成建站并提升流量?  详解MySQL数据库的安装与密码配置  如何用IIS7快速搭建并优化网站站点?  佐糖AI抠图怎样调整抠图精度_佐糖AI精度调整与放大细化操作【攻略】  jQuery validate插件功能与用法详解  标题:Vue + Vuex + JWT 身份认证的正确实践与常见误区解析  Laravel如何实现API资源集合?(Resource Collection教程)  浅析上传头像示例及其注意事项  如何在 Pandas 中基于一列条件计算另一列的分组均值  javascript中的try catch异常捕获机制用法分析  Python自然语言搜索引擎项目教程_倒排索引查询优化案例  微信小程序 require机制详解及实例代码  Laravel如何配置中间件Middleware_Laravel自定义中间件拦截请求与权限校验【步骤】  Laravel如何使用Guzzle调用外部接口_Laravel发起HTTP请求与JSON数据解析【详解】  个人网站制作流程图片大全,个人网站如何注销?  EditPlus中的正则表达式 实战(4)  详解jQuery中基本的动画方法  Laravel Seeder填充数据教程_Laravel模型工厂Factory使用  微信小程序 五星评分(包括半颗星评分)实例代码  网站页面设计需要考虑到这些问题  佛山网站制作系统,佛山企业变更地址网上办理步骤?  Laravel如何处理文件下载请求?(Response示例)  Laravel请求验证怎么写_Laravel Validator自定义表单验证规则教程  如何快速选择适合个人网站的云服务器配置?  百度浏览器如何管理插件 百度浏览器插件管理方法  android nfc常用标签读取总结  Laravel如何发送系统通知_Laravel Notifications实现多渠道消息通知  Windows10怎样连接蓝牙设备_Windows10蓝牙连接步骤【教程】